Sql server varbinary example to and from a flat file posted on april 23, 2015 by rob stgeorge 1 comment even though sql server and ms word share the same parent microsoft, it is not always easy to get them to play together nicely. Implicit conversion from data type varchar max to varbinary max is not allowed. Such files are read converted to an array of bytes and inserted into sql server varbinary or image fields. Stored procedure to import files into a sql server. Is there any way to upload a file to a varbinary on sql server without writting a program to do it. How to insert a file pdf into a varbinary sql server column and retrieve it later. Im trying to create a cursor, looping throug all files, and using left or substring function to get the number, inserting it into a. Insert and retrieving varbinarymax field in stored. Insert binary data like images into sql server without frontend application hi, ive loaded sql server 2008 express in my laptop and trying to create a table with a column of varbinary max type. Upload pdf files into database in binary format using asp. We can also check these files in the filestream container as well. Import and export excel files into varbinary max in sql. Sql insert querynot inserting varbinary max data sql varbinary max to webbrowser control convert pdf data without create pdf file how to insert null value to varbinary max database column.
Insert pdf into sql svr 2008 varbinarymax sql server. Insert and retrieving varbinarymax field in stored procedure learn more on the sqlservercentral forums. I only wanted to insert values to insert values to this column as other coulmns are filled. I need to store a pdf in my existing db table record. Many time we need to work with files and most of the time developers prefer to store files on physical location of server which is very difficult because it will consume lots of memory of server, so in this article we will learn how to upload files in binary format into database using asp. How to insert a stored procedure data into a column of an existing table sql server inserting image at varbinary from sql query analyzer performance issue in retrieving data from a varbinary max field. How to insert big file into varbinarymax codeproject. Hello all, i got a sql server db with pdf stored in varbinary column field. Inserting binary objects into a sql server table using a stored procedure and powershell. I opened pdf in acropdf and then i try to save this file to correctly row in database table. How read and show a pdf saved as varbinary into sqlserver.
Getting the varbinary data into a varchar field learn more on the sqlservercentral forums. How to insert pdf file into varbinarymax sql server forums. Sql server varbinary example to and from a flat file. How to upload multiple images to sql server sqlshack. Net how to store and retrieve pdf, xls files into database using 2010 advertise. Export documents saved as blob binary from sql server. Hi i have a table products which has a coulmn name productimage of type varbinary max. What are the advantages of storing as a varbinary file. Working with varbinary in ms sql server jeff drumm may 9, 2017 at 12. How to loadimport a pdf file into azure db table as base64 column. How to store and retrieve file in sql server database.
Solved storing pdf files as binary in sqlserver codeproject. So, today in this article ill show you how to save file directly into the database in varbinary data so, you can access any file from the database. I use image object to save image jpg file into sql varbinary column as code below. We can verify both the files insert successfully in the sql filestream table as per the following images. Uploading a file to a varbinary on sql server server fault. Converting varbinary back to byte solutions experts. Here, ill explain how to convert any files such as word, excel, csv, pdf, images, audio and video, and many other files into varbinary data and save into the sql server database with a simple. Hi, i need to insert a pdf file into a sql server 2005 varbinarymax field using visual basic 6. Hi, i have a couple of pdf and txt files which i convert to byte and write it into a varbinary field in a sql db. Our team was tasked with putting scanned expense report receipts. Csv file as a blob object in the table in ms sql server. If ssis is available another option was to use a ssis package as per ssis importing binary files into a varbinary max column. Inserting binary objects into a sql server table using a. Im looking to take the results of a report run a pdf file from crystal reports, serialize it, stick it into a varbinary field, and then later be able to deserialize it and present it back to the user.
Inserting file data into a varbinarymax column fishofprey. Sql varbinarymax to webbrowser control convert pdf data without. This number is the id of another table, so, if the pdf file starts with 123, i need to insert it into the id 123. Blobs include files such as images, pdf, word or excel documents, audio, video files. So looks like i cant use single around binary value, and 0x12343122 is actual binary value, when i use cast0x1234 as varbinary max it convert it into another value of course, thinking its varchar. Mssql has never been very good about natively interfacing with the os. We need to configure sql server full text search on this filestream table to query on the document. I have never used this utility before and looked but could find no examples on how to use bcp insert such pdf, etc filesusing bcp. Insert binary data like images into sql server without. Upload and save file in database as varbinary data in asp. How to insert a file pdf into a varbinary sql server. How to insert all pdf files from a folder into a varbinary.
Load an image file to the table insert into imageasvarbinary imagename, varbinarydata. Create a table to contain the image as a varbinary or image create table imageasvarbinary id int identity1,1, imagename varchar50, varbinarydata varbinary max. How do i insert a file into sql server 2005 varbinarymax. So it sounds like you do not have to parse the pdf, just import the entire thing into one column. Simple image import and export using tsql for sql server. Executescalar returns the first 2033 characters only refer to msdn. How read and show a pdf saved as varbinary into sqlserver db 09012016, 07. How do i retrieve a pdf file stored in sql server database and view it in the pdf viewer control using vb. Insert binary data like images into sql server without frontend application. Net, id like to insert a file word document, excel, pdf, text into a sql database varbinary column, and also extract and save the file from the database. When i retrieve the varbinary data into the respective formats pdf txt i see that the data in the file is all messed up. How to insert all pdf files from a folder into a varbinarymax column. How do i insert a file into sql server 2005 varbinary max.
How to insert all pdf files from a folder into a varbinary max column in sql using a query. Hi, i use visual studio 2017 and its possible to load pdf to databse and then view this pdf. The data type that we are going to use to store images is the varbinarymax. Ive tried to use document database field assigning name and size. Solved insert data in sql server varbinary datatype. Using openrowset to bulk insert file data into a va rbinarymax column ssis. One to read a file into a varbinary max and the other to write a varbinary max to a file. I cant get this to work with bulk insert with or without a format file. First issue you have is you are using executescalar. How to store binary image blob sql server and load it. Wrapper stored proc does the following receive xml and pdf content.
747 145 53 1383 298 414 339 223 664 989 71 141 1008 1229 623 84 85 1313 541 966 1313 641 1199 476 860 1160 287 660 804 1410 835 602 1044 1128 218 904 1185 438 652